So it is really beginning to look like we live at The Atherton Hotel. This week we head back for the wedding of Courtney & Jordan. It's New Year's Eve Weekend and of all the people to come down sick this week. It is AJ. AJ is the DJ/Emcee for the night and has been battling the stomach bug that has been floating around. 

Tonight will be a little more scaled back than most weddings, mostly because the bride and groom wanted it that way, but also because AJ is running on fumes and barely even is aware where he is at.

Once the bride and groom return from pictures with Daniel James Photography we have our grand entrance. The bridal party walks into "Forever" by Chris Brown and the Bride and Groom enter to "Happy" by Pharell Williams. Once Courtney & Jordan are seated we get to some toasts from the Best Man and Maid Of Honor. 

Dinner is then served, another meal served up by the staff at The Atherton Hotel. Dinner is followed by cake cutting. Jordan and Courtney cut the cake to "Grow Old With You" by Adam Sandler, and were very nice to each other when it came to feeding one another.

Dinner was followed by the first dance to "Only To Be With You" by Judah & The Lion


This was followed by the Father/Daughter dance, Courtney's father has passed away and Courtney decided to share the dance with people who have been there to support her and guide her through the trying times. Courtney picked "No Hard Feelings" by Avett Brothers to dance with these special people to.








Next up it was time for Jordan to take the floor with his mother for the Mother/Son Dance. Jordan chose "What A Wonderful World" by Louis Armstrong to dance to.


We then opened up the dance floor for the rest of the night and partied.



We closed out the night with "Thinking Out Loud" by Ed Sheeran

Congratulations To Mr & Mrs Jacoby.
